What they do

An Accounts Payable or Receivable Clerk keeps records of accounts and financial transactions, with specific responsibility for Accounts Payable/Receivable. Works for a business or bookkeeping service. Provides information for financial and tax reports completed by an accountant.

Job Description

Description We are looking for an Accounts Payable Clerk to support day-to-day accounting operations for a construction-focused organization in Lincoln, Nebraska. This Long-term Contract position is ideal for someone who enjoys detailed financial work, can manage a steady volume of invoice activity, and is comfortable handling routine payables responsibilities with accuracy. The person in this role will contribute to timely payment processing, organized recordkeeping, and responsive support for vendors and internal accounting needs.
Responsibilities:
  • Enter vendor invoices accurately and promptly into the accounting system while verifying key payment details.
  • Compare invoices with purchase orders and related documentation to confirm amounts, approvals, and coding before processing.
  • Prepare and support regular payment cycles, including check runs, to help ensure vendors are paid on schedule.
  • Maintain orderly financial files and documentation so records remain complete, accessible, and audit-ready.
  • Address routine supplier questions regarding payment status, invoice details, and standard account issues in a thorough manner.
  • Assist the accounting team with month-end close activities by organizing payable records and helping reconcile outstanding items.
  • Support related accounting tasks as needed, including basic billing, account review, and other transactional finance duties.
  • Help identify and resolve discrepancies in invoices or supporting documents by coordinating with internal teams and vendors. Requirements
  • 2+ years of experience in accounts payable or a closely related accounting support role.
  • Working knowledge of core AP processes, including invoice entry, payment handling, and document matching.
  • Familiarity with accounting functions such as account reconciliation, billing support, and basic accounts receivable activities.
  • Strong attention to detail with the ability to process financial information accurately and consistently.
  • Proficiency with data entry and standard office or accounting software used for transaction processing.
  • Ability to organize records effectively, manage recurring tasks, and meet routine deadlines.
  • Clear communication skills for handling basic vendor inquiries and collaborating with accounting staff.
